tropo Posted September 8, 2014 Share Posted September 8, 2014 Why not try Bells travel services only 250 baht per person from bkk airport to your hotel in pattaya and same coming back. if you book on line it only 230 baht per person They have a very limited timetable is one reason. The last bus leaves the airport at 6pm, so it's useless to anyone arriving after 5pm. The first bus leaves Pattaya at 6am, so assuming most people want to be at the airport at least 90 minutes before departure, that's useless for anyone departing earlier than 9am. Even if you find a trip, it could add hours onto your travel time waiting for the next bus. IMO it's not worth the savings, especially if you travel with a partner.
